When they first switched to the modern numbering system in 1994, the "Made in..." line was still put at the bottom. Different plants switched to including it in the body at different times. You will find some 1995 items with the line across the bottom. This appears to be an authentic Taylor zip. The zipper looks pretty rumpled but that seems common with this style.

Hi,

Can anyone authenticate these Coach Court bags?


1. The first is in a beige/stone colour. It seems to be in very good condition, but I don't know if Coach every made their original Courts in this beige/stone colour. Can anyone confirm?

http://www.ebay.ca/itm/121097441686...X:IT&_trksid=p3984.m1438.l2648#ht_2590wt_1300

2. And the second, in a tan colour. Also in excellent condition, though it seems to be missing a hangtag. I also had the same question that Hyacinth had about the nickel hardware. Most of the circa 1998/1999 Court bags I found online seem to have brass hardware, so I was quite surprised to see this one with nickel. Does anyone know if Coach produced the Courts in both types of hardware?

http://www.ebay.ca/itm/281096226575...X:IT&_trksid=p3984.m1438.l2648#ht_1930wt_1300

3. Lastly, should I be looking for authenticity cards? I seem to recall getting one when I got my Coach bag in 1996, but maybe that's just my imagination...

Thanks!
Sorry I didn't get to these sooner. They are both authentic. Bone is an authentic color. The second one is probably camel. I have a Rambler's Legacy in that color with nickel hardware from the same year and plant. It is brushed nickel, rather than shiny silver. Coach bags used to come with a card to send in to register your bag. They were still including it in 1996 but it didn't make any sense once they no longer had unique serial numbers. I guess they discontinued it sometime after that. There wasn't an authenticity card, as such, like you get with Chanel where you could match the numbers.

1- it seems ok. And Coach made Court Bags in Bone in 1998.

2- looks ok, and yes they did.

3- absolutely NOT. What does a piece of paper prove? The whole "authenticity card" thing is a scam used by counterfeiters. If the crooks can fake a purse, what's so hard about faking a piece of printed paper? There's no such thing with Coaches and Coach has never used them.

And most of the Registration Cards I've seen on Ebay and other online sites are fake and so are the bags they're included with, especially if they're recent styles.
